Accessing and Understanding the Widget

First things first, let's make sure you know how to access the widget. It's usually located in the bottom-left corner of your taskbar. You'll likely see a weather icon, but that's just the tip of the iceberg. Hovering over the icon (or clicking it) will expand the widget into a full-fledged information panel.

• Launch the Widget: Simply hover your mouse over the weather icon on the taskbar or click on it directly. • Navigating the Interface: Once expanded, you'll see a feed of news, weather, sports scores, stock prices, and more. Scroll through to get a feel for the types of information available. • Understanding the Layout: Notice the different sections and categories. There's usually a top stories section, followed by personalized news based on your interests.

Customizing Your Interests

This is where the magic happens! The widget isn't just serving up random news; it's trying to learn what you care about. You need to guide it along the way. Personalizing your interests is key to getting the most out of the widget.

• Accessing the Customization Options: Click on the three dots (ellipsis) in the top-right corner of the widget panel. Select "Manage interests" to open a dedicated settings page. • Selecting Categories of Interest: Explore the various categories, such as technology, business, sports, entertainment, and more. Click on the topics that pique your interest. The more specific you are, the better the widget can tailor its content to your liking. • Following Publishers and News Sources: Within each category, you can further refine your preferences by following specific publishers and news sources. This ensures you're getting information from the sources you trust and enjoy. • Fine-Tuning Your Feed: As you use the widget, pay attention to the articles that appear. If you see something you don't like, click on the three dots next to the article and select "Not interested in this story" or "Don't like this source." This helps the widget learn your preferences over time.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Like any piece of software, the News and Interests widget can sometimes encounter glitches or issues. Here are some common problems and how to fix them.

• Widget Not Displaying: If the widget is missing from your taskbar, make sure it's enabled in the Taskbar settings (as described above). Also, check to see if your Windows installation is up-to-date. Outdated software can sometimes cause compatibility issues. • Widget Displaying Incorrect Information: If the widget is showing the wrong location or weather information, double-check your location settings in Windows. Make sure the correct location is enabled and that the widget has permission to access it. • Widget Crashing or Freezing: If the widget is constantly crashing or freezing, try restarting your computer. This can often resolve temporary software glitches. If the problem persists, you may need to reinstall the widget or update your graphics drivers. • Content Not Updating: If the widget isn't updating its content, check your internet connection. Make sure you're connected to a stable network. Also, try clearing the widget's cache. This can sometimes resolve issues with outdated or corrupted data.

Frequently Asked Questions

Still have some questions about the Windows 11 News and Interests widget? Here are some common FAQs to help you out.

• Q: Can I customize the order of the news sources in my feed? A: Unfortunately, the widget doesn't currently allow you to manually reorder the news sources in your feed. However, the widget learns from your interactions over time and prioritizes the sources you engage with most frequently. • Q: Does the News and Interests widget drain my battery? A: The widget does consume some battery power, as it constantly updates its content in the background. However, the impact is generally minimal. You can reduce battery consumption by adjusting the update frequency or disabling live updates altogether. • Q: Can I use the News and Interests widget on older versions of Windows? A: The News and Interests widget is a feature specifically designed for Windows 11. It is not available on older versions of Windows, such as Windows 10 or Windows 7. • Q: How do I report a bug or issue with the News and Interests widget? A: If you encounter a bug or issue with the widget, you can report it to Microsoft through the Feedback Hub app. This helps Microsoft identify and fix problems with the widget.
